Starting Out: Easy Hotel Pickup and Scenic Drive
Your adventure begins with a hotel pickup, usually from Saranda, Ksamil, or nearby, with a prompt 10-minute wait at the lobby. From there, a knowledgeable guide will take the wheel in a well-maintained 4×4, and you’ll start your leisurely journey through Albania’s scenic countryside. This part of the experience is key to setting the tone—expect picturesque views rolling past as you leave the more populated areas behind.
First Stop: The Blue Eye—A Natural Marvel
The highlight of the day is undoubtedly the Blue Eye, a spring famous for its stunning clarity and vibrant hues. You’ll spend about 100 minutes here, which is ample time to take a dip, snap photos, or simply marvel at the sight of this natural phenomenon seen from 50 meters away. Visitors often mention the refreshing cool waters and the breathtaking scenery, making it a perfect spot to relax and re-energize.
A common compliment from travelers is how “spectacular” the views are and how the water’s clarity makes it feel almost surreal. Some reviews note that the area can get busy, so arriving early or bringing a towel and swimsuit is a good idea. The walk from the parking area is manageable, but be prepared for some uneven terrain.
Second Stop: Gjirokaster Fortress—History on a Hilltop
Next, the tour takes you to Gjirokaster Fortress, a hilltop landmark that dominates the town skyline. Spending around an hour here, you’ll explore the fortress with a guide and take in panoramic views of the surrounding valleys. This site offers a tangible connection to Albania’s past, with impressive stone walls and historic structures that have withstood centuries.
Many visitors comment on how “the views are breathtaking” from the fortress, and the guide’s insights bring this historic site to life. After the guided tour, you’re encouraged to take photos, soak in the scenery, or wander at your own pace. The castle entrance fee is included, so no surprises there.
More Great Tours NearbyExploring Gjirokaster Old Bazaar: Culture and Crafts
The tour then transitions into the charming Old Bazaar district, where you’ll enjoy about 100 minutes of free time. This is where Albania’s craftspeople showcase traditional woodwork, textiles, and stone carvings. As you stroll, you can browse handcrafted souvenirs, enjoy a local snack, or simply soak up the lively atmosphere.
Many travelers praise this part of the trip for the authentic feel—“the bazaars buzz with energy, and the craftsmen are eager to share their skills.” It’s an excellent opportunity to pick up unique gifts or mementos. The lively streets also make for great photo opportunities.
Return Journey: Scenic Drive Back to Your Hotel
After a full day of exploring, you’ll hop back into the vehicle for the short return drive (about 70 minutes), with the option for one final photo stop or rest break. Your guide will coordinate your drop-off at your hotel or a designated location, wrapping up a day packed with memorable sights.

FAQs
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, the tour includes pickup and drop-off from your hotel in Saranda, Ksamil, or nearby locations.
How long does the tour last?
The tour is approximately 6.5 hours, with starting times available depending on your schedule.
What sites are visited?
You’ll visit the Blue Eye spring, Gjirokaster Fortress, and the Old Bazaar, with guided commentary at the fortress and optional sightseeing time at other stops.
Are entrance fees included?
Yes, the entrance fees for Gjirokaster Castle and the Blue Eye are included in the price.
Is this tour suitable for everyone?
It’s best suited for active travelers comfortable with some driving, walking, and uneven terrain. It’s not suitable for wheelchair users.
What should I bring?
Bring a camera and comfortable clothes, especially swimwear if you wish to take a dip at the Blue Eye.
Can I cancel the booking?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ility if your plans change.
